NBN Co sees large jump in 250Mbps, gigabit users – iTnews
As six-month discount comes into play.

NBN Co has revealed that the number of customers on 250Mbps or up to gigabit broadband plans has surpassed half a million, a 20-fold or more increase since the end of last year.
The network operator revealed the impact of its ‘focus on fast’ campaign, which cut the cost of 100Mbps and above services from February 1 this year, and has led to some aggressive offers in-market.
